This invention relates to a polymerization process for producing polymers with narrow molecular weight distributions. It comprises addition of monomer and initiator to a reaction vessel using a selected monomer feed profile and an initiator feed profile calculated from a polymerization kinetics relationship between a selected degree of polymerization and monomer concentration, initiator concentration, reaction temperature and a polymerization efficiency factor to obtain an approximately constant degree of polymerization for polymer produced during the polymerization process. The polymerization efficiency factor accounts for deviations from ideal kinetics relationships. This process can be used in a semi-batch or semi-continuous mode as a method of producing polymers with narrow molecular weight distributions, particularly acrylate and methacrylate polymers.
